Originally Posted by RawSheed

k what's more prestigious?

BHOF or NBAHOF?

or are they even 2 different distinct entities?
For the 63,723rd time, there is NO NBA HALL OF FAME. It's the Naismith Memorial Basketball Hall of Fame. It recognizes important contributors and performers at all levels of basketball, from high school to pros, as well as journalists, execs, GMs, etc. It's a sports hall of fame, not a league hall of fame. I agree there should be an NBA Hall, but it doesn't exist, so we're stuck with what we have. Oh, and there's a panel of international voters that strictly considers international players and coaches.
